Procurement Committee Chairperson

Henties Bay Municipality
Henties Bay
09.2017 - 11.2023
  • Approval and recommendation of procurement plan to the Accounting officer
  • Approval and recommendation of relevant procurement methods
  • Approval and recommendation of the bid documents
  • Consideration and discussion of findings by the Bid Evaluation Committee (BEC)
  • Review and considerations of variations
  • Recommendation of awards or non-award to the Accounting Officer.
